>In 2004 I had a real dream crew of 12 boys and 2 adutls. I was able to
>push the number since only one of the boys had been before, an 18-year-old
>who could move up to an adult spot in case one of the two adults had
>trouble. The other adult had also never been. I had an extremely strong
>leader as Crew Chief, who had been named by the Elks Lodge as one of the
>top two boy scouts in Ohio that year. This crew could routinely have camp
>completely set up within less than 30 minutes. However, with the stress of
>Philmont and being so close together, even this crew developed some
>differences among themseves. Two days before we came off the trail, the
>Crew Chief called a meeting of only the 12 boys with no advisors to, rather
>than the thorns and roses in which nothing negative is said, just let
>everyone speak their peace and get it out of their system. This worked
>extremely well, and restored a very cohesive unit again. I wish I could
>say I thought of it, but it was much better coming from the Crew Chief.
>After 20 years as scoutmaster, I continue to learn from the boys. Boys
>learn to lead by leading, let them.
